Output 83776f2d2acd17ee920b5b029264fffd10a45fcdb1cc70591e2a8df778d2443f:7

value
36839066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030e885667cbc2afbfffad2ddf6bcb6f246e8d02 OP_EQUAL
address
31yBMrpdRWeXjaGcbsuHvsLpfQCRVaBzPX
transaction
83776f2d2acd17ee920b5b029264fffd10a45fcdb1cc70591e2a8df778d2443f
spent
true